London Gazette 28th January 1916

War Office, London, S.W., 28th January, 1916.

The  following despatch has been received from General Sir Ian Hamilton, G.C.B. 1, Hyde Park Gardens, London, W.

11th December, 1915.

My LORD, I have the honour to submit herewith a list of the names of the officers and men whose services I wish to bring to your Lordship's notice in connection with the operations described in my despatch of 11th December, 1915.

I have the honour to be, Your Lordship's most obedient Servant, IAN HAMILTON, General.

Royal West Kent Regiment (Territorial Force). Temporary Lieutenant-Colonel A. T. F. Simpson (Lieutenant-Colonel and Honorary Colonel late 4th Battalion, Royal West Kent Regiment).

London Gazette 4th May 1917.

War Office, 4th May, 1917. TERRITORIAL FORCE. INFANTRY.

Royal West Kent Regiment - Lieutenant Colonel (temporary) A. T. F. Simpson to be Lieutenant Colonel, with precedence

as from 12th September  1914.  - 5th May 1917.
